First, the design of “smarter” libraries by focused mutagenesis may be a crucial start-up for a fast and successful outcome. Then library assembly and expression are also key steps that benefits from modern molecular biology progresses.
WebMay 21, 2024 · These focused mutagenesis methods reduce library sizes and therefore reduce screening burden, accelerating the rate of finding improved enzymes. WebWe then used a genetic screen to identify MntS mutants that were defective in binding to MntP. The identified mutants from the random screen were transformed into E.coli cells using site-directed PCR mutagenesis and were further tested to quantify the defects of protein-protein interactions through two-hybrid and Mn sensitivity assays.
